Decadent Stilton and Pear Savory Tart instructions

Ingredients

all-purpose flour 8 ounces (Measure out and sift if necessary.)
salt 1/2 teaspoon (Use fine sea salt for better flavor.)
butter 4 ounces (Softened to room temperature.)
Stilton cheese 8 ounces (Crumble into small pieces.)
pear 1 medium (Peeled, cored, and sliced thinly.)
eggs 3-4 large (Use large eggs and beat well.)
half-and-half 1 cup (Use warmed half-and-half for better mixing.)

Instructions

1
Preheat your oven to 450°F (232°C).
2
In a large mixing bowl, combine the all-purpose flour and salt. Gradually add the softened butter, using your fingers to work it into the flour until you achieve a crumbly texture.
3
Press the mixture into the bottom and up the sides of an 8-inch or 9-inch tart pan with a removable bottom. Gently prick the bottom of the pastry with a fork to prevent bubbling.
4
Blind bake the crust for 5 minutes. Remove from the oven and allow it to cool slightly.
5
Lower the oven temperature to 350°F (177°C).
6
Evenly sprinkle the crumbled Stilton cheese over the cooled tart shell.
7
Arrange the thinly sliced pear on top of the Stilton in a beautiful spoke pattern.
8
In a separate bowl, beat the eggs and gradually stir in the warmed half-and-half until well combined.
9
Carefully pour the egg mixture over the pears and Stilton, filling the tart pan until it is nearly full.
10
Bake the tart in the preheated oven for 30-40 minutes, or until the filling is set and lightly golden on top.
11
Allow the tart to cool for 5 minutes before slicing and serving. Enjoy it warm or at room temperature.
